HTML 4.0 Programming Level 1

« back to previous page

Description: Students will learn basic Hypertext Markup Language (HTML) and HTML design techniques. Topics include formatting text, adding links, adding graphics and sound, and creating tables and forms.

Prerequisites: Navigating the Internet/Web or equivalent skills

Length: One day
